MySQL中如何随机获取一条记录
在MySQL中,要随机获取一条记录,可以使用 ORDER BY RAND()
语句,并配合 LIMIT 1
来限制结果集只返回一条记录。以下是一个示例SQL查询:
SELECT * FROM your_table ORDER BY RAND() LIMIT 1;
请将 your_table
替换为你的实际表名。这个查询会随机选择表 your_table
中的一条记录。
注意:对大型数据表使用 ORDER BY RAND()
可能会导致性能问题,因为这需要对全表进行随机排序。对于大型数据集,考虑其他更高效的随机选择记录的方法。
评论已关闭